REFERRED JOURNAL PAPERS: PDF Files

1.    A correction for a paper by J. Smoller and A. Wasserman, Journal of Differential Equations 77 (1989), 199--202. (SCI) PDF

2.    On positive solutions of some semilinear elliptic equations, Journal of the Australian Mathematical Society (Series A) 50 (1991), 343--355. (with N. D. Kazarinoff) (SCI) PDF

3.    Bifurcation and stability of positive solutions of a two-point boundary value problem, Journal of the Australian Mathematical Society (Series A) 52 (1992), 334--342. (with N. D. Kazarinoff) (SCI) PDF

4.    Bifurcation of steady-state solutions of a scalar reaction-diffusion equation in one space variable, Journal of the Australian Mathematical Society (Series A) 52 (1992), 343--355. (with N. D. Kazarinoff) (SCI) PDF

5.    Bifurcation of positive solutions of generalized nonlinear undamped pendulum problems, Bulletin of the Institute of Mathematics, Academia Sinica 21 (1993), 211--227. PDF

6.    Remarks on the monotonicity and convexity of the time maps of some two-point boundary value problems, Chinese Journal of Mathematics 21 (1993), 259--269. PDF

7.    On the time map of a nonlinear two-point boundary value problem, Differential and Integral Equations 7 (1994), 49--55. PDF

8.    Positive solutions for a class of nonpositone problems with concave nonlinearities, Proceedings of the Royal Society of Edinburgh 124A (1994), 507--515. (SCI) PDF

9.    On S-shaped bifurcation curves, Nonlinear Analysis, Theory, Methods & Applications 22 (1994), 1475--1485. (SCI) PDF

10.Bifurcation of an equation from catalysis theory, Nonlinear Analysis, Theory, Methods & Applications 23 (1994), 1167--1187. (with F.-P. Lee) (SCI) PDF

11.Bifurcation of an equation arising in porous medium combustion, IMA Journal of Applied Mathematics 56 (1996), 219--234. (SCI) PDF

12.Rigorous analysis and estimates of S-shaped bifurcation curves in a combustion problem with general Arrhenius reaction-rate laws, Proceedings of the Royal Society of London, Series A 454 (1998), 1031--1048. (SCI) PDF

13.Existence and multiplicity of boundary blow-up nonnegative solutions to two-point boundary value problems, Nonlinear Analysis, Theory, Methods & Applications 42 (2000), 139--162. (SCI) PDF

14.Existence and multiplicity of an equation from pool boiling on wires, Quarterly of Applied Mathematics 58 (2000), 331--354. (SCI) PDF

15.An exact multiplicity theorem involving concave-convex nonlinearities and its application to stationary solutions of a singular diffusion problems, Nonlinear Analysis, Theory, Methods & Applications 44 (2001), 469--486. (with D.-M. Long) (SCI) PDF

16.An explicit formula of the bifurcation curve for a boundary blow-up problem, Dynamics of Continuous, Discrete and Impulsive Systems Ser. A Math. Anal. 10 (2003), 431--446. (with Y.-T. Liu and I-A. Cho) (SCI Expanded) PDF

17.Exact multiplicity results for a p-Laplacian problem with conacve-convex-concave nonlinearities, Nonlinear Analysis, Theory, Methods & Applications 53 (2003), 111--137. (with I. Addou) (SCI) PDF

18.Exact multiplicity and ordering properties of positive solutions of a p-Laplacian Dirichlet problem and their applications, Journal of Mathematical Analysis and Applications 287 (2003), 380--398. (with T.-S. Yeh) (SCI) PDF

19.On the exact structure of positive solutions of an Ambrosetti-Brezis-Cerami problem and its generalization in one space variable, Differential and Integral Equations 17 (2004), 17--44. (with T.-S. Yeh) PDF

20.A complete classification of bifurcation diagrams of a Dirichlet problem with concave-convex nonlinearities, Journal of Mathematical Analysis and Applications 291 (2004), 128--153. (with T.-S. Yeh) (SCI) PDF

21.Exact multiplicity results for a p-Laplacian positone problem with concave-convex-concave nonlinearities, Electronic Journal of Differential Equations 2004 (2004), 1--25. (with I. Addou) PDF

22.Shape and structure of the bifurcation curve of a boundary blow-up problem, Taiwanese Journal of Mathematics 9 (2005), 201--214. (with Y.-T. Liu) (SCI) PDF

23.Explicit necessary and sufficient conditions for the existence of a dead core solution of a p-Laplacian steady-state reaction-diffusion problem, Discrete and Continuous Dynamical Systems - Series A, Supplement Volume, 2005, 587--596. (with S.-Y. Lee and C.-P. Ye) (SCI) PDF

24.The structure of the solution set of a generalized Ambrosetti-Brezis-Cerami problem in one space variable, Journal of Mathematical Analysis and Applications 313 (2006), 441--460. (with W.-Y. Hsia and T.-S. Yeh) (SCI) PDF

25.A complete classification of bifurcation diagrams of a p-Laplacian Dirichlet problem, Nonlinear Analysis, Theory, Methods & Applications 64 (2006), 2412--2432. (with T.-S. Yeh) (SCI) PDF

26.On the evolution and qualitative behaviors of bifurcation curves for a boundary value problem, Nonlinear Analysis, Theory, Methods & Applications 67 (2007), 1316--1328. (SCI) PDF

27.A complete classification of bifurcation diagrams of a p-Laplacian Dirichlet problem, Journal of Mathematical Analysis and Applications 330 (2007), 276--290. (with S.-Y. Lee, J.-Y. Liu, and C.-P. Ye) (SCI) PDF

28.Exact structure of positive solutions for a p-Laplacian problem involving singular and superlinear nonlinearities, Rocky Mountain Journal of Mathematics 37 (2007), 689--708. (with T.-S. Yeh) (SCI Expanded) PDF

29.Exact multiplicity of boundary blow-up solutions for a bistable problem, Computers and Mathematics with Applications 54 (2007), 1285-1292. (with J. Shi) (SCI) PDF

30.Exact multiplicity of solutions and S-shaped bifurcation curves for the p-Laplacian perturbed Gelfand problem in one space variable, Journal of Mathematical Analysis and Applications, 342 (2008), 1175-1191. (with Tzung-Shin Yeh) (SCI) PDF

31.On the evolution and qualitative behaviors of bifurcation curves for a boundary value problem. II, Nonlinear Analysis, Theory, Methods & Applications. (2008) (with W.-C. Huang) (SCI) PDF

32.Explicit necessary and sufficient conditions for the existence of nonnegative solutions of a p-Laplacian boundary blow-up problem, Taiwanese Journal of Mathematics, 13 (2009). (with Pei-Yu Huang and Ming-Ting Shieh) (SCI) PDF

33.A theorem on reversed S-shaped bifurcation curves for a class of boundary value problems and its application, Nonlinear Analysis 71 (2009), 126-140. (with Tzung-Shin Yeh) (SCI) PDF

34.A complete classification of bifurcation diagrams of classes of a multiparameter Dirichlet problem with concave-convex nonlinearities, Journal of Mathematical Analysis and Applications, 349 (2009), 113-134. (with Kuo-Chih Hung) (SCI) PDF

35.A complete classification of bifurcation diagrams of classes of multiparameter p-Laplacian boundary value problems, Journal of Differential Equations, 246 (2009), 1568-1599. (with Kuo-Chih Hung) (SCI) PDF

36.Classification of bifurcation diagrams of a p-Laplacian Dirichlet problem with examples, Journal of Mathematical Analysis and Applications, 369 (2010), 188-204. (with Tzung-Shin Yeh) (SCI) PDF

37.Bifurcation diagrams of a p-Laplacian Dirichlet problem with Allee effect and an application to a diffusive logistic equation with predation, Journal of Mathematical Analysis and Applications, 375 (2011), 294-309. (with Kuo-Chih Hung) (SCI) PDF

38.Classification and evolution of bifurcation curves for a multiparameter p-Laplacian Dirichlet problem, Nonlinear Analysis, 74 (2011), 3589-3598. (with Kuo-Chih Hung) (SCI) PDF

39.A theorem on S-shaped bifurcation curve for a positone problem with convex-concave nonlinearity and its applications to the perturbed Gelfand problem, Journal of Differential Equations, 251 (2011), 223-237. (with Kuo-Chih Hung) (SCI) PDF

40.A complete classification of bifurcation diagrams of a p-Laplacian Dirichlet problem. II. Generalized nonlinearities,Taiwanese Journal of Mathematics, 16 (2012), 1265-1291. (with Feng-Lin Wang) (SCI) PDF

41.On the existence of a double S-shaped bifurcation curve with six positive solutions for a combustion problem, Journal of Mathematical Analysis and Applications, 392 (2012), 40-54. (K.-C. Hung and C.-H. Yu) (SCI) PDF

42.Global bifurcation and exact multiplicity of positive solutions for a positone problem with cubic nonlinearity,Journal of Differential Equations, 252 (2012), 6250-6274. (with C.-C. Tzeng and K.-C. Hung) (SCI) PDF

43.Classification of bifurcation diagrams of a p-Laplacian nonpositone problem, Communications on Pure and Applied Analysis,  12 (2013), 2297-2318. (with P.-C. Huang and T.-S. Yeh) (SCI) PDF

44.Global bifurcation and exact multiplicity of positive solutions for a positone problem with cubic nonlinearity and their applications, Transactions of the American Mathematical Society, 365 (2013), 1933-1956. (with Kuo-Chih Hung) (SCI) PDF

45.S-shaped bifurcation curves for a combustion problem with general Arrhenius reaction-rate laws, Communications on Pure and Applied Analysisaccepted to appear. ( 2013) (with C.-Y. Chen and K.-C. Hung) (SCI) PDF

46.S-shaped and broken S-shaped bifurcation diagrams for a multiparameter spruce budworm population problem in one space dimension, Journal of Differential Equations, 255 (2013), 812-839. (with Tzung-Shin Yeh) (SCI) PDF

47.Global bifurcation diagrams and exact multiplicity of positive solutions for a one-dimensional prescribed mean curvature problem arising in MEMS, Nonlinear Analysis, 89 (2013), 284-298. (with Y.-H. Cheng and K.-C. Hung) (SCI) PDF
